Directions

Bring a large pot of water to boil; cook pasta until al dente.

While pasta is cooking, in medium saucepan, melt 2 tablespoons of the margarine.

Remove from heat; add flour and stir until blended in.

Whisk in stock and milk, stirring over med heat until mixture comes to a boil and thickens Reduce heat to low. Stir in cheeses and seasonings. Continue stirring until cheese is melted. Remove from heat and set aside. In a large skillet, melt remaining 1 tablespoon margarine. Add remaining ingredients. Cook vegetables, stirring constantly, for about 5 minutes, until tender/crisp. Reduce heat to low. When noodles are done, drain well. Toss with vegetables; stir in cheese sauce. Garnish with scallion curls.
